I did a bit of searching around and I think the early ones came in those thin blister packs from the late 80s and early 90s that deteriorate badly. Would explain why nobody seems to have the packaging for one. The smaller Kutmaster tools came in a small purple box. Perhaps there were some MMs that came in a blue or purple box?

I don't have a problem with them making the newer designs in China, but they are not doing a good job with it.  :facepalm:
The original MM is all about getting the job done. The newer tools(RealTree and Wrenchheads for example) are just a bit junky and gimmicky. The tool locking on the new models is garbage, the cutters don't work, and they are too heavy compared to the MultiMasters.
Now is a good time to get a NIB MM, because their prices are going to go crazy when Kutmaster stops selling the U.S. made MMs.
